Wiktionary

adv

Etymology: Etymology tree English pitiless Middle English -ly English -ly English pitilessly From pitiless + -ly.

  1. In a pitiless manner.

    The simple questions of the tattered man had been knife thrusts to him. They asserted a society that probes pitilessly at secrets until all is apparent.

    They treated the prisoners roughly [...] slashing pitilessly with their whips to drive them as wretched animals before them.
